Paul’s conversion was so powerful. Being educated, Paul was able to articulate the Hebrew scriptures. His Roman citizenship allowed him to minister without restrictions. He was the “Hebrews of Hebrews” which allowed him to enter the synagogues. Paul’s background allowed him to establish churches and teach Christians how to live.
